Install

pip install churn-cli

For PDF export support (--only pdf):

pip install "churn-cli[pdf]"

Requires Python 3.8+ and a Gemini API key from aistudio.google.com


Usage

Churn has two commands: interview for interview prep, and docs for documentation generation.

churn interview /path/to/your/project
churn docs /path/to/your/project

churn interview

Generates level-wise interview Q&A from your codebase.

churn interview /path/to/project
churn interview /path/to/project --level senior          # skip interactive prompt
churn interview /path/to/project --questions 15           # custom question count (default: 10)
churn interview /path/to/project --output report.md        # custom output file
churn interview /path/to/project --format json             # json output instead of markdown
churn interview /path/to/project --ignore tests/ --ignore migrations/   # skip folders

Options

-q, --questions INTEGER           Number of questions  [default: 10]
-l, --level [fresher|mid|senior]  Skip prompt, set level directly
-o, --output TEXT                 Output file  [default: churn-output.md]
-f, --format [md|json]            Output format  [default: md]
-i, --ignore TEXT                 Extra folders to ignore (repeatable)

churn docs

Generates complete project documentation from your codebase.

churn docs /path/to/project
churn docs /path/to/project --only readme,prd          # generate only specific docs
churn docs /path/to/project --only readme,prd,arch,pdf # include a combined PDF report
churn docs /path/to/project --output my-docs/           # custom output folder
churn docs /path/to/project --ignore tests/             # skip folders

Options

--only TEXT        Comma separated: readme, prd, arch, pdf  [default: readme,prd,arch]
-o, --output TEXT  Output folder  [default: churn-docs/]
-i, --ignore TEXT  Extra folders to ignore (repeatable)

Output

churn-docs/
├── README.md       — what it does, setup, usage, tech stack
├── PRD.md          — problem, features, roadmap inferred from code
├── ARCHITECTURE.md — folder structure, data flow, key files
└── REPORT.pdf       — all three combined, shareable (only with --only ...,pdf)

Each doc is generated strictly from what's in the code — README, PRD, and ARCHITECTURE don't invent features, flags, or files that aren't actually there. The PRD's roadmap section is inferred from real TODOs and unfinished code paths, not guesses.

PDF export uses xhtml2pdf (pure Python) — no native GTK/Cairo dependencies, so it works out of the box on Windows, macOS, and Linux. Requires pip install "churn-cli[pdf]".

What It Does

Churn scans a local project directory, identifies the most frequently edited files using git log, compresses the code, and sends it to the Gemini API.

  • churn interview returns interview questions with detailed answers, saved as markdown or JSON.
  • churn docs returns a full documentation set (README, PRD, ARCHITECTURE, and an optional combined PDF report).

Files Scanned

Included: .py .js .ts .tsx .jsx .java .go .cpp .env.example

Ignored: node_modules/ .git/ dist/ build/ __pycache__/ .next/ venv/ churn-env/


Privacy

  • No code is stored at any point
  • Everything runs locally — no backend server
  • Code is sent to Gemini API for processing only
  • Gemini API does not use API request data for model training
